Heritage Crafts as Modern Luxury Assets

Many global buyers underestimate how adaptable Indian craftsmanship can be when integrated into contemporary luxury design strategies.

Traditional artisan techniques can be customized to align with modern market demands.

Examples include:

Handloom Textiles

Luxury throws, cushions, table linens, wall hangings, and bespoke hospitality textiles can be developed using traditional weaving methods while incorporating modern color palettes and contemporary design aesthetics.

Handcrafted Ceramics

Artisanal ceramic collections can be customized for luxury retailers, boutique hotels, interior design firms, and lifestyle brands.

Woodcraft & Carving

Traditional woodworking techniques can be adapted into premium decorative objects, luxury storage solutions, and architectural décor pieces.

Natural Fiber Collections

Sustainable consumer preferences continue driving demand for handcrafted products utilizing jute, cotton, bamboo, cane, and other renewable materials. The result is a collection that feels globally relevant while preserving authentic craftsmanship.

Scaling From Sample Approval to Multi-Container Production

Many buyers successfully develop beautiful prototypes but encounter major challenges when scaling.

Sample success does not automatically guarantee production success.

Luxury brands require consistency.

Customers expect identical quality across every shipment.

This demands disciplined manufacturing controls.

Prototype Validation

Before mass production begins:

  • Dimensions are verified
  • Materials are validated
  • Finishes are approved
  • Functional testing is completed

Golden Sample Approval

The approved prototype becomes the official benchmark for production.

Every subsequent production batch is measured against this standard.

Batch Consistency Controls

Manufacturing teams follow documented production protocols to maintain consistency across larger volumes.

Production Monitoring

Continuous quality checkpoints reduce deviations before products reach final inspection.

This structured approach enables seamless transition from small sampling quantities to container-scale production.

Logistics Excellence: Protecting Luxury Products Across Continents

Luxury products must arrive in perfect condition.

A flawless product loses value if damaged during transit.

This is particularly important for:

  • Ceramics
  • Glass décor
  • Handcrafted furniture
  • Premium textiles
  • Decorative accessories

Vahatt.in implements structured logistics risk mitigation protocols.

Multi-Layer Protective Packaging

Products are packed using export-grade materials designed for international transit conditions.

Moisture Protection Systems

Particularly important for:

  • Handloom products
  • Natural fibers
  • Wood-based décor

Shatter Prevention Engineering

Fragile product categories utilize reinforced packaging methodologies designed to withstand extended ocean freight movement.

Container Optimization

Strategic loading plans improve protection while maximizing freight efficiency.

These practices reduce transit-related risks while supporting predictable delivery performance.
